The variety of times a short article obtains shared on matters for activists, politicians, authors, online-publishers and advertisers. They therefore have an interest in understanding the number of shares, ideally also predicting it prior to the short article is being published. With brand-new approaches of such as it is feasible to acquire insights right into the core characteristics of a short article.


The features consist of variables explaining words, web links, electronic media, time, search phrases, understandings from and the number of post shares. With the dataset being openly readily available, a reasonable amount of data evaluation has been carried out.


One "classification analysis". 30 November 2020. utilized maker finding out methods, namely,,, and to predict the top ten percent most regularly shared posts. The final thought is, that the average search phrases within a write-up and the average popularity of claimed keywords have the best effect on the quantity of shares a post receives.

This year's record is available in the midst of an international wellness pandemic that is unmatched in modern times and whose financial, political, and social consequences are still unfolding. The seriousness of this dilemma has actually reinforced the demand for reputable, precise journalism that can notify and educate populations, but it has actually also advised us just how open we have actually come to be to conspiracies and false information.


Local News OnlineLocal News Online
Much of the data in this publication was collected prior to the infection struck several of the nations included in this survey, so to a huge degree this represents a snapshot of these historical patterns. To obtain a sense of what has actually transformed, we duplicated crucial parts of our study in six countries this hyperlink (UK, United States, Germany, Spain, South Korea, and Argentina) in very early April.

Journalism issues and is in need once again. One trouble for authors is that this added passion is creating also much less earnings as advertisers brace for an inevitable recession and print income dips. Against this history it is most likely we'll see an additional drive towards digital registration and other visitor settlement versions which have shown significant guarantee in the last couple of years.


At the same time, making use of online and social media sites substantially enhanced in a lot of countries. WhatsApp saw the biggest growth in basic with rises of around ten percentage points in some nations, while majority of those surveyed (51%) used some kind of open or shut online group to connect, share details, or take part in a neighborhood assistance network.


Media depend on was greater than two times the degree for social networks, video clip systems, or messaging solutions when it involved info about COVID-19. From our broader dataset gathered in January: International concerns regarding false information remain high. Also before the coronavirus crisis hit, even more than half of our international example claimed they were concerned regarding what is true or incorrect on the web when it involves information.

In our January poll throughout nations, less than 4 in ten (38%) stated they rely on most news the majority of the moment a fall of four percent factors from 2019. Less than half (46%) stated they trust the information they utilize themselves. Political polarisation connected to rising uncertainty seems to have actually weakened trust in public broadcasters particularly, which are losing support from political upholders from both the right and the left.


Partisan preferences have actually slightly increased in the USA considering that we last asked this question in 2013 however even right here a silent majority seems to be seeking news that at the very least attempts to be objective. As the news media adjust to changing designs of political communication, most people (52%) would prefer them to prominently report incorrect declarations from politicians as opposed to not emphasise them (29%).


We have actually seen significant increases in settlement for on pop over to this web-site the internet information in a variety of nations consisting of the USA 20% (+4) and Norway 42% (+8 ), with smaller sized surges in a variety of various other markets. It is necessary to note that across all nations lots of people are still not paying for online information, even if some authors have considering that reported a 'coronavirus bump'.

Customers think they are obtaining better info. A large number of people are flawlessly content with the information they can access for totally free and we observe a really high proportion of non-subscribers (40% in the United States and 50% in the UK) who state that nothing might persuade them to pay.


Access to news remains to come to be a lot more distributed (Local News Online). Across all nations, simply over a quarter (28%) prefer to begin their news journeys with an internet site or app. Those aged Our site 1824 (so-called Generation Z) have an also weak connection with web sites and applications and are greater than twice as most likely to choose to access information using social networks


To counter the move to various systems, authors have actually been wanting to construct direct links with consumers using email and mobile informs. In the United States one in 5 (21%) access an information e-mail weekly, and for nearly half of these it is their key way of accessing news. Northern European nations have been a lot slower to embrace e-mail news networks, with just 10% using email news in Finland.
